In jobs where federal law doesn’t apply, Texas law has some different restrictions on working hours. 14 and 15-year-old employees may work up to 8 hours a day and up to 48 hours a week. On school days, they can only work between 5 am and 10 pm, and when school is out they can work as late as midnight. Generally, speaking children 13 years old or younger may not work in Texas, except in some limited situations. Youth who are 14 and 15 years old may work in a broader range of jobs, but are significantly limited in the number of hours per day and per week they may work, especially when school is in session.

14- and 15-Year-Olds Can Work: • Outside school hours • After 7 a.m. and until 7 p.m. (hours are extended to 9 p.m. June 1 through Labor Day) • Up to 3 hours on a school day • Up to 18 hours in a school week • Up to 8 hours on a non-school day • Up to 40 hours in a non-school week Once teens reach 16 years of age, they can work any ...

In order for 15-year-olds to work in Texas, they must obtain a work permit. This permit can be obtained through their school or from the Texas Workforce Commission. The process usually involves filling out an application, providing proof of age and parental consent, and obtaining a signature from a school official.

According to Texas law, 14- and 15- year olds cannot: Work more than eight hours per day. Work more than 48 hours per week. Cannot begin work before 5 a.m. Cannot work after 10 p.m. on the day before a school day, including days before summer school sessions.
